private void loadListRowIntoDetails(int index) { DataGridViewRow row = CouponGridView.Rows[index]; activeID = int.Parse(row.Cells[0].Value.ToString()); data_models.Models.Coupon m = CouponControllers.GetOneById(_context, (int)activeID); NumbertextBox.Text = Convert.ToString(m.CouponNumber); ValueTextBox.Text = toPaddedString((decimal)m.DiscountPrice); StartdateTimePicker.Value = m.StartDate; EnddateTimePicker.Value = m.EndDate; statusCheckBox.Checked = m.Status; }
private void updatebutton_Click(object sender, EventArgs e) { String error = validateAllControls(); if (error == "") { data_models.Models.Coupon m = new data_models.Models.Coupon(); updateObjectFromForm(ref m); CouponControllers.UpdateItemByObject(_context, (int)activeID, m); loadMenuData(); showMenuList(); } else { MessageBox.Show(error, "Validation Error", MessageBoxButtons.OK, MessageBoxIcon.Error); } }
private void loadMenuData() { List <data_models.Models.Coupon> coupons = CouponControllers.GetItemsSortByCategory(_context); CouponGridView.DataSource = coupons; }
private void yesbutton_Click(object sender, EventArgs e) { CouponControllers.DeleteItemById(_context, (int)activeID); loadMenuData(); showMenuList(); }